Default valve guide ?s

whats up mopar gang?just a quick ? I was check out some cam specs for sm blocks on the Hughes site when I noticed a footnote that said max lift for the stock heads was .450" unless you cut the valve guides down. is this true? if not what is the safest lift I can use? triggerbear

The last 340 I helped dial in had a 509 purple shaft and we had to pull it apart and have the tops of the guides machined down due to the retainers hitting them.It sounded like rhoads lifters but they were regular mopar stuff.Caught it in time and didnt hurt anything else.So I would think its a good tip.
